ROBERT EMERSON Obituary

ROBERT CHARLES EMERSON - RICHMOND - Robert Charles Emerson, 78, of Richmond, passed away peacefully, with his family at his side, on Monday, Jan. 7, 2013. He was born on Dec. 27, 1934, in Island Pond, to the late Charles and Bessie Emerson. Robert is survived by his wife of 55 years, Carolyn (Bishop) Emerson. Robert served 24 years with the United States Air Force, including service during the Korean and Vietnam wars. Robert retired at McDill AFB, Tampa, Fla., as a master sergeant and held the position of first sergeant of his squadron. While on active duty, Robert pursued a higher education and earned a Master's degree in Criminal Justice from Rollins College in May 1979. Robert's second career was with the State of Florida Probation Office. He retired after 20 years of service. In 1997, Robert and Carolyn returned to Vermont and settled in Richmond. Robert volunteered for 11 years with Meals on Wheels and was a proud member of the NRA. Robert was a loving father of his two sons, John Emerson and his wife, Theresa, of Richmond, and James Emerson and his fiance, Donna, of Apopka, Fla. He is also survived by his brother, Wayne Emerson and wife, Carol; his sister, Brenda Brown and husband, John; his brother, Donald and wife, Paula; his sister, Barbara Mullin; and sister-in-law, Karen Emerson, all of Florida. Robert was predeceased in 1957 by his brother, John Emerson. He was a beloved grandfather to four grandsons, Chris Emerson and wife, Hannah, Ben Emerson, Michael Emerson and his namesake, Robert Emerson. He was a great-grandfather to Annabelle and three step great-grandchildren, Gracie, Lilly and Emma. He is also survived by many nieces, nephews and friends, including those of the 555 "Triple Nickel" Air Force Squadron.
